Phlebotomist Salary in Bozeman, Montana

The median phlebotomist salary in Bozeman, MT is $43,539 per year, which is 13.0% above the national median and 21.5% above the Montana state average.

Phlebotomist Salary in Bozeman by Experience

In Bozeman, an entry-level phlebotomist earns around $33,900, while experienced professionals earn up to $56,500 per year. The local cost of living index is 115% of the national average.

Salary Percentiles in Bozeman, MT

Percentile Bozeman
10th Percentile $32,770
25th Percentile $37,290
Median (50th) $43,539
75th Percentile $51,980
90th Percentile $58,760

How to Become a Phlebotomist in Bozeman

Education

Most phlebotomist positions require a postsecondary nondegree award. Bozeman and the surrounding Montana area have institutions offering relevant programs.

Job Outlook

Nationally, phlebotomist employment is projected to grow 8% over the next decade (faster than average). Demand in Bozeman may vary based on local industry and population growth.

Frequently Asked Questions: Phlebotomist Salary in Bozeman

How much does a Phlebotomist make in Bozeman, MT?
The median phlebotomist salary in Bozeman, Montana is $43,539 per year, which is 13.0% above the national median of $38,530. Salaries range from $32,770 (10th percentile) to $58,760 (90th percentile).
How much does a Phlebotomist make per hour in Bozeman?
Based on the median annual salary of $43,539, a phlebotomist in Bozeman earns approximately $21 per hour assuming a standard 2,080-hour work year.
How does Bozeman compare to the Montana state average for phlebotomist pay?
Bozeman's median phlebotomist salary of $43,539 is 21.5% above the Montana state average of $35,833. The local cost of living index is 115% of the national average.
What is the cost of living in Bozeman, MT?
Bozeman has a cost of living index of 115% compared to the national average. This means a phlebotomist salary of $43,539 in Bozeman has less purchasing power than the same salary in an average-cost city.
